Su'a Cravens: Power Ranking 5-Star Recruit's Top 5 Suitors

Edwin WeathersbyJun 5, 2018

Vista Murrieta (Ca.) 5-star prospect Su'a Cravens is one of the very elite high school football players in the country.

A two-way standout, Cravens could realistically see himself line up at safety, running back, outside linebacker or receiver in college.

The 6'1", 205-pound athlete has a ton of offers, and his recruitment has been ever the fluid situation. However, Cravens recently announced his final five schools and the date that he'll announce his choice.

For this read, I'm going to power-rank all five final schools for Cravens.

5. Nebraska

1 of 5

Big Red is a finalist for Cravens, as the talented prospect likes Nebraska some.

The Cornhuskers haven't done too hot in recruiting recently, but landing a player like Cravens would be a huge coup for Bo Pelini.

Nebraska is a finalist for Cravens, but out of all five, they appear to have the slimmest chance. That being said, don't rule out a trip to Nebraska before Cravens makes his decision, which could surge Big Red in front. 

4. Ohio State

2 of 5

The Buckeyes are another Big Ten school that is on Cravens' radar.

He'd be an elite player for Ohio State soon, as it's well documented that the Buckeyes need more speed, quickness and athleticism on the roster, which Cravens has a ton of.

Urban Meyer and his staff are going to have to really hustle for Cravens, but he likely will take a trip to OSU before he makes his choice.

3. Michigan

3 of 5

The Wolverines have the top recruiting class in the country right now according to Scout.com, so Cravens has to know that he will be joining a top-notch class should he sign with Big Blue.

A trip to the Midwest to see Michigan, Ohio State and Nebraska is a possibility. If Brady Hoke and his staff can get Cravens on campus, this could be a tough option to turn down for Cravens.

With the way Michigan is recruiting these days, they have to be viewed as a major threat by all other four teams on his list.

2. UCLA

4 of 5

UCLA has surged up Cravens' list. The high school star has taken many unofficial trips to Westwood throughout the process.

Cravens recently told Greg Biggins of Scout.com: "I like both local schools a lot."

With him being from Los Angeles, UCLA offers Cravens a chance to stay close to home and play in front of his friends and family for four more years.

The Bruins could also offer him the best chance at playing time as a true freshman.

1. USC

5 of 5

USC has been considered the favorite for Su'a Cravens for nearly the entire time he's been on the recruiting radar.

It's widely known that he was a Trojan fan as a kid, USC has been recruiting him hard, and that other top prospects have spoken to him about joining them at SC. It's also close to home.

Even Cravens' mother digs USC. He told Scout.com: "(My mother) has always wanted me to go to USC."

It's important to note that Cravens is making his decision on his mother's birthday, June 6.

That's a good sign for USC. It'll be a shock if he announced for somewhere else.
